Q4 2021 looks set to be the most important and eagerly anticipated trading quarters in modern history. Following the restrictions on business due to the global pandemic that has resulted in thousands of brands disappearing from malls around the world, the retail stakes have never been higher. Research conducted by DigitalCommerce360 predicts ‘U.S. consumer spending online to grow 12.1% year over year this 2021 holiday season’, further underlying a renewed consumer confidence and perhaps, a return to the good times.
However, competition for customers online is reaching new heights. Data from Statista for 2020 showed that over 800,000 businesses launched in the US alone. A high number for sure, but in fact it accounts for just 10.7% of the world’s start ups last year. In a marketplace with no borders and boundaries competition comes from everywhere and anywhere.
